Abstract

This study analyzes the effects of Foreign Direct Investment (FDI), trade openness, and corruption control on economic growth in the ASEAN-6 region, which includes Indonesia, Thailand, Malaysia, Vietnam, the Philippines, and Cambodia. Annual data for the period 2009–2023 obtained from the World Bank were analyzed using panel data regression. The results indicate that FDI has a positive effect on economic growth, highlighting the important role of foreign investment in stimulating regional economic activity. In contrast, trade openness has a negative effect on economic growth, suggesting that trade liberalization has not yet generated optimal outcomes. Meanwhile, corruption control does not have a significant effect on economic growth. These findings emphasize the importance of more adaptive investment and trade policies to enhance the economic competitiveness of the ASEAN-6 region.

Abstract

Sharia mutual fund Net Asset Value (NAV) functions as a critical indicator used to assess the performance of Indonesia’s sharia-compliant financial instruments, where its movements are greatly influenced by macroeconomic conditions and financial market dynamics. Using the VECM model, the analysis explores how the Indonesian Sharia Stock Index and various macroeconomic factors relate to and affect the NAV of sharia mutual funds in both the short and long term during the period January 2012–December 2024. The findings indicate that, in the short run, inflation reduces NAV, whereas the exchange rate and ISSI contribute positively, and interest rates do not exhibit significant effects. Over the long term, NAV is pressured downward by inflation and interest rates, while the exchange rate and ISSI maintain their positive influence.

Abstract

This study aims to describe the role of the village government in supporting food-sector MSMEs in Berbek Village, Sidoarjo Regency, in achieving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) Goal 8: Decent Work and Economic Growth. Using a qualitative case study approach, data were collected through interviews, observations, and documentation involving village officials and local MSME actors. The findings indicate that the Berbek Village Government acts as a facilitator, regulator, and catalyst through entrepreneurship training, assistance with business licensing and halal certification, product promotion, and facilitation of access to capital in collaboration with financial institutions and local associations. These initiatives contribute to increased productivity, expanded market reach, and improved welfare, particularly among women engaged in home-based industries. Furthermore, collaboration among the village government, village-owned enterprises (BUMDes), and MSME communities strengthens an inclusive and sustainable local economic ecosystem aligned with the SDGs.

Abstract

In consumer cyclicals entity listed on the Indonesia Stock Exchange for the period of 2021–2024, this study intends to examine the impact of institutional ownership, auditor turnover as well as audit complexity on audit report latency, with company size serving as a moderating variable. A quantitative approach is utilised in the present study using the logistic regression method. The publicly available financial records and annual reports of the company were the sources of the research data. While audit complexity and institutional ownership had no effect on audit report delays, studies demonstrate that auditor switching does. Also, the moderation test shows that there is no effect of firm size on the correlation between audit report lag and institutional ownership, auditor change, or audit complexity.

Abstract

This study aims to analyze the effects of village facilitator competence, village government commitment, and oversight by the Village Consultative Body (BPD) on the transparency of village financial management. Employing an explanatory quantitative design, the research was conducted in villages in Donggala Regency. Data were collected through a survey of village government officials, BPD members, and community leaders, and subsequently analyzed using Structural Equation Modeling–Partial Least Squares (SEM-PLS). The results indicate that village facilitator competence, village government commitment, and BPD oversight each have a positive and significant effect on the transparency of village financial management. These findings underscore the importance of strengthening the capacity of village facilitators, ensuring the consistency of village government commitment, and enhancing the effectiveness of the BPD's oversight function in promoting information transparency and reducing information asymmetry in village financial management.

Abstract

This study examines the factors influencing tax compliance among freelance individual taxpayers registered at the Senapelan Primary Tax Office (KPP Pratama Senapelan) in Pekanbaru A quantitative approach using multiple linear regression was employed to measure the effect of each variable. Data were collected through questionnaires distributed to 100 respondents. The findings reveal that only E-Billing implementation and tax sanctions significantly affect compliance. E-Billing has a positive effect, indicating that the more user-friendly the digital system, the higher the taxpayer compliance. Tax sanctions, however, have a significant negative effect, suggesting that overly harsh legal threats may reduce voluntary compliance. Meanwhile, perceived corruption, tax fairness, and socialization showed no significant partial influence. These results suggest that freelance workers are more responsive to technological convenience and proportional sanctions than to normative factors.

Abstract

This study aims to examine whether dividend policy moderates accounting conservatism and capital structure on firm value. The method used is quantitative. Strict screening of secondary data using purposive sampling obtained 17 companies in the non-primary consumption sub-sector of the Indonesia Stock Exchange between 2021 and 2024. MRA analysis and multiple linear regression were used in this study using SPSS 25. The findings show a positive and significant result between accounting conservatism and capital structure with company value, while dividend policy is unable to strengthen or weaken both relationships.

Abstract

This exploration focuses on the effectiveness of the East Semarang Pratama Tax Office (KPP Pratama) in achieving its targets through public education, administrative modernization, and the implementation of tax relaxation. This study positions taxpayer discipline as an intermediary element linking policy to institutional outcomes. By involving all office staff (97 respondents) as research subjects through a census approach, data collected through a questionnaire instrument was processed using the SEM-PLS technique. The research findings confirm that massive outreach, a reliable bureaucratic system, and the tax amnesty program have a strong linear correlation with public compliance behavior. This positive impact simultaneously has implications for strengthening productivity and achieving overall organizational targets.

Abstract

This study aims to analyze the role of village management accounting in improving program effectiveness, financial accountability, and resource allocation in Namo Simpur Village. The research uses a quantitative causal associative approach. Data were collected through questionnaires from 31 village officials involved in financial management and program implementation. Data analysis involved applying classical assumption tests. simple linear regression, and partial significance tests. The results indicate that management accounting has a positive and significant role in supporting the effectiveness of program implementation, enhancing financial management accountability, and helping to allocate resources more effectively and efficiently. This study concludes that the implementation of management accounting is an important factor in improving the quality of village governance.

Abstract

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k menguji efek penerapan kebijakan Program Makan Bergizi Gratis (MBG) terhadap reaksi pasar modal indonesia yang disahkan pemerintah pada 6 Januari 2025. Reaksi pasar diukurnya memakai dua proksi, yakni abnormal return(AR) dan trading volume activity (TVA) pada perusahaan yang tergabung dalam indeks LQ45 di BEI. Metode memakai event study dengan waktu estimasi 100 hari sebelum peristiwa dan periode jendela 11 hari (5 hari sebelum hingga 5 hari sesudah peristiwa). Sampel penelitian memakai teknik sampling jenuh, alhasil seluruh 45 perusahaan dalam indeks LQ45 dipakai jadi objek penelitiannya. Analisis data diolah memakai SPSS versi 25. Hasil penelitian mengungkapkan bahwa tidak terdapat perbedaan signifikan pada abnormal return sebelum dan sesudah peristiwa. Namun, ditemukan adanya perbedaan signifikan pada trading volume activity (TVA) yang mencerminkan perubahan perilaku investor dalam merespons kebijakan tersebut.
